Windowed Fourier Transform of Experimental Robotic Signals with Fractional Behavior
This paper analyzes the signals captured during impacts and vibrations of a mechanical manipulator. The signals are treated through signal processing tools such as the fast Fourier transform and the windowed Fourier transform. The Fourier spectrum of several signals presents a noninteger behavior. The experimental study provides useful information that can assist in the design of a control system to deal with the unwanted effects of vibrations.
